Production Supervisor - 3rd Shift
About the Role
This position reports to the Production Manager. The role requires thorough knowledge of the equipment and processes in the areas, as well as acquired knowledge of planning, organizing, controlling, coordinating, and directing manufacturing personnel. The supervisor will possess a high level of supervisory capability, which ensures leadership and motivation of subordinates to attain high standards of quality and productivity. The role requires the ability to react to change in a timely and organized manner, evaluate and weigh alternatives, establish appropriate priorities, and formulate sound decisions affecting all phases of the operation. The supervisor will foster harmonious relations within their shift and between shifts. Accountability includes safety, product quality, exercising cost control, meeting production schedules, the proper uses of direct and indirect labor, accurate record-keeping and reporting, minimizing scrap and rework costs, training new and existing personnel, and communicating with other supervisory and management personnel as well as subordinates. Frequent use of computer terminals and personal computers is required. The supervisor must have thorough knowledge and awareness of the safety issues related to each operation performed within the department, and must assure that all employees adhere to safe practices at all times. Understanding of The Valmont Way theory of Lean Manufacturing principles is required.
Core Responsibilities
- Demonstrate active employee engagement by conducting effective everyday "stand up-start up meetings" to identify if all employees are "fit for duty" that day; utilize stretch and flex exercises as part of warming up for work and to identify if employees demonstrate motion concerns.
- Enforce work hardening policy: any new hires (direct hire or temps) should only be scheduled for 40 hours/week for first 30 days without exceptions.
- Ensure Valmont safety absolutes are not compromised at any time.
- In case of a safety infraction (near miss, first aid, recordable, LTI, property damage): assist in the investigation, demonstrate effective containment actions are in place for all employees to return to their work centers safely, and present root cause findings as well as countermeasures (short term and long term) to all employees as well as management.
- Demonstrate "first time quality – work attitude" by making sure any equipment issues are immediately reported, owning the root cause analysis of ANY rejected pole, performing time sensitive fact finding to ensure repeat rejects do not occur, and partnering with Quality Supervisor to ensure correct solution is in place and documenting performance issues with HR.
- Effectively plan work including daily task assignments (with employee assignments planned in advance) and executing weekly schedules and reporting any schedule concerns.
